Iroquois Point-area historical earthquake activity is significantly below Hawaii state average. It is 86% smaller than the overall U.S. average.

On 3/5/1981 at 14:09:39, a magnitude 5.5 (5.0 MB, 5.5 ML, Class: Moderate, Intensity: VI - VII) earthquake occurred 67.6 miles away from Iroquois Point center
On 5/20/2005 at 15:52:07, a magnitude 4.1 (4.1 ML, Depth: 6.2 mi, Class: Light, Intensity: IV - V) earthquake occurred 33.7 miles away from the city center
On 10/23/1991 at 12:50:26, a magnitude 4.1 (4.1 ML, Depth: 18.5 mi) earthquake occurred 58.6 miles away from the city center
On 8/15/2002 at 18:06:49, a magnitude 3.9 (3.9 MD, Depth: 4.2 mi, Class: Light, Intensity: II - III) earthquake occurred 24.5 miles away from Iroquois Point center
On 8/29/2006 at 06:09:58, a magnitude 3.8 (3.8 MB, 3.6 MD, Depth: 18.7 mi) earthquake occurred 43.7 miles away from the city center
On 8/13/2008 at 11:01:43, a magnitude 3.0 (3.0 ML, Depth: 6.2 mi) earthquake occurred 35.6 miles away from Iroquois Point center
Magnitude types: body-wave magnitude (MB), duration magnitude (MD), local magnitude (ML)
